An Act relative to dependent eligibility for Chapter 115 benefits
This bill changes eligibility rules for veterans' dependents under Massachusetts' Chapter 115 benefits program. It allows dependents of veterans to qualify for benefits even if they lack the standard one-day Massachusetts residency requirement, provided they can prove they lived in Massachusetts for at least one year before applying. The key change removes the previous residency barrier for these dependents, replacing it with a one-year residency proof requirement. This directly affects veterans' spouses and children seeking benefits under this specific program.
